This taxon is not in use as it is currently considered to be a junior synonym of Iridomyrmex rufoniger.
Nomenclature
The following information is derived from Barry Bolton's Online Catalogue of the Ants of the World.
- septentrionalis. Iridomyrmex rufoniger var. septentrionalis Forel, 1902h: 465 (w.) AUSTRALIA. [First available use of Iridomyrmex rufoniger r. pallidus var. septentrionalis Forel, 1901b: 23; unavailable name.] Junior synonym of rufoniger: Heterick & Shattuck, 2011: 133.
